Warning Signs You Need Downspout Failure Water Removal
Ignoring the signs of a failing downspout can lead to costly water damage and even health risks. Identify these warning signs early to prevent bigger problems: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ors in your home or business can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ore the smell as it can lead to more serious problems.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of leaking downspouts or other water damage issues. Address the problem quickly to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of excessive water exposure or poor drying techniques. Don’t wait to fix the problem as it can lead to more costly repairs.

Downspout Failure Water Removal Cost In Boynton Beach, FL
The cost of downspout failure water removal var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Boynton Beach, FL. Estimates start at $500 and can go up to $2,500 or more depending on the extent of the damage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ning required |
| Dehumidification and drying equipment rental | $100 – $300 | Duration of rental, type of equipment needed |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ect.
